ABSTRACT
Objective To determine the effect of dihydroartiminisin on the proliferation and phosphorylation of mitogen-activated protein kinase (MAPK) in SKOV3 and OVCAR3 ovarian cancer cell lines.Methods Methyl thiazolyl tetrazolium assay was performed to evaluate the anti-proliferative effect of dihydroartiminisin in SKOV3 and OVCAR3 cells,and Western blot was used to determine its effect on phosphorylation level of MAPK,including extra-cell regulated kinase (ERK)1/2 and p38 protein kinase,in the two cell lines.Results Dihydroartiminisin inhibited the proliferation of ovarian cancer cells in vitro,with a mean of 50% inhibition concentration (IC50) at 72 h of (9.0 ±1.4) μmol/L for SKOV3 and (5.5 ±1.2)μmol/L for OVCAR3 respectively. Compared to cells without dihydroartiminisin treatment,phosphorylation level of ERK 1/2 in SKOV3 and OVCAR3 cells treated with dihydroartiminisin decreased by 64.2% and 75.3% respectively (P<0.05),while phosphorylation of p38 protein kinase in SKOV3 and OVCAR3 only decreased by 8.5% and 6.4% respectively (P >0.05).Conclusion Dihydroartiminisin can inhibit the proliferation of ovarian cancer cell in vitro, probably through down-regulation of the phosphorylation of ERK 1/2 in ovarian cancer cells.
